@santinobch/os-window-angular
TypeScript icon, indicating that this package has built-in type declarations

0.2.3 • Public • Published

OS window like, component for Angular

Demo: https://santinobch.github.io/os-window-angular/

Getting started

Read the wiki on how to get started, i promise it's a light read ;)

Yes it works :D ! Here are some features:

Multiple Themes!

Multiple Windows

Resize

Resize

Movement

Movement

Bounce

Bounce

Maximize

Maximize

Close

Close

Roadmap

At the moment, im working on this alone in my free time, using this to build my own portafolio. Also learning in the way how to make, publish and mantain a npm package.

If i have enough time i will keep this updated periodically.

If you want to help me, start by reading Compiling the Library, and please start an issue.

(づ。◕‿‿◕。)づ

Things i want to implement/fix before 1.0:

  • At the moment changing for example the theme of a window at runtime will not work, themes can only be applyed at component initialization.
  • Zoom fix (At the moment zooming a maximized window will make some weird behavior)
  • Resize Z-Index fix (Resizing a window will not change it's z-index value)
  • The Win98 Vaporwave theme needs some love
  • Buttons, all of them: Radio, Switches, Checkboxes, etc...
  • Text inputs
  • Loading bars
  • Tool bars
  • Tree view

After realease 1.0:

  • Add more themes: Win XP, Mac OSX 10.6, Win 3.1, Etc...
  • Eventually some templates (By example a file manager template)

Package Sidebar

Install

npm i @santinobch/os-window-angular

Weekly Downloads

1

Version

0.2.3

License

MIT

Unpacked Size

629 kB

Total Files

43

Last publish

Collaborators

  • santinobch